What are the options for Ecuadorian citizens who wish to work in the United States in the field of research and development through the H-1C visa for certified nurses?

Ecuadorian certified nurses can work in the United States through the H-1C visa. This visa is intended for healthcare professionals who are registered nurses and wish to work in areas with medical staff shortages. An offer of employment from a hospital in a designated location is required.

Can I obtain an Argentine DNI if I am an Argentine citizen but was born abroad?

Yes, if you are an Argentine citizen but were born abroad, you can obtain an Argentine DNI. You must present documentation that proves your Argentine citizenship, such as your parents' birth certificate or your own citizenship by option.
